Man charged with attempted murder over shooting of NFL player

December 10, 2025

NFL player Kris Boyd, a 29-year-old cornerback for the New York Jets, was shot twice in the abdomen outside a Manhattan restaurant in mid-November following a confrontation with strangers who had taunted him and his companions. The shooting left Boyd in critical condition with a bullet lodged in his pulmonary artery, though he has since been released from the hospital and recently visited his team's practice facility. Authorities arrested 20-year-old Frederick Green in Buffalo, New York, approximately three weeks after the incident, finding him hiding at his girlfriend's residence with an altered appearance.

What action is being taken

  • Frederick Green is being charged with attempted murder, assault, and criminal possession of a weapon
  • Boyd is recovering from his injuries and has visited his teammates at the Jets practice facility
